The postal code 979-2521 belongs to Japan’s seven-digit postal system, designed and operated under the standards of Japan Post, the country’s official postal authority. Japanese postal codes use the structure X X X–X X X X, such as 1 0 0–X X X X (example only). The first three digits designate the broader delivery region, while the last four digits identify specific districts or block-level routing zones. This code corresponds to Akagi in the Fukushima Ken prefecture, positioned near latitude 37.7515 and longitude 140.938. Routing follows Prefecture → City/Ward → District → Block.
